This measure, which was so criticized by teachers, was introduced at the beginning of the 2024 school year.
A survey shows that the strict application of the level groups in mathematics and French is in decline in colleges. Less than 20% of schools still apply "strictly"

Read Full ArticleFew schools actually apply the measure which aims to create groups by skills of students, according to a survey by the Snes union, which franceinfo reveals exclusively.
The college level groups, launched by Gabriel Attal while he was Minister of Education, are not popular with the schools: less than one in five have set them up, says a study by Snes, the main secondary education union, reveals franceinfo this Monday.
